本文目录导读:
随着大数据时代的到来,数据存储的需求日益增长,存储池作为现代数据中心的核心组成部分,其数据布局对整个系统的性能和稳定性至关重要,本文将深入解析存储池数据布局,探讨如何优化存储空间,提升性能。
存储池概述
存储池是指将多个物理存储设备(如硬盘、固态硬盘等)虚拟化,形成一个逻辑上的存储空间,通过存储池,可以实现对物理存储设备的统一管理和调度,提高存储系统的性能和可靠性。
存储池数据布局原理
1、数据分布
图片来源于网络,如有侵权联系删除
存储池数据布局的核心在于数据分布,合理的数据分布可以降低数据访问的延迟,提高存储系统的性能,常见的数据分布策略包括:
(1)均匀分布:将数据均匀地分布在存储设备上,降低单个设备的负载,提高数据访问速度。
(2)轮询分布:按照一定的顺序将数据写入存储设备,避免某个设备负载过重。
(3)热数据优先:将频繁访问的数据存储在性能较高的存储设备上,提高数据访问速度。
2、数据校验
数据校验是保证数据完整性和可靠性的重要手段,常见的数据校验方法包括:
(1)CRC校验:对数据进行循环冗余校验,检测数据传输过程中的错误。
(2)RAID技术:通过冗余技术提高数据可靠性,如RAID 5、RAID 6等。
图片来源于网络,如有侵权联系删除
3、数据压缩
数据压缩可以减少存储空间占用,提高存储系统的利用率,常见的数据压缩方法包括:
(1)无损压缩:不损失原始数据信息,如gzip、zlib等。
(2)有损压缩:牺牲部分数据质量,提高压缩率,如JPEG、MP3等。
优化存储池数据布局的策略
1、根据业务需求选择合适的存储池类型
不同业务对存储性能、可靠性和成本的要求不同,根据业务需求,选择合适的存储池类型,如高性能存储池、高可靠性存储池等。
2、合理分配存储空间
根据存储设备的性能和容量,合理分配存储空间,避免某个设备负载过重。
图片来源于网络,如有侵权联系删除
3、定期进行数据均衡
定期进行数据均衡,确保数据均匀分布在存储设备上,提高数据访问速度。
4、选择合适的RAID级别
根据业务需求和存储设备的性能,选择合适的RAID级别,提高数据可靠性。
5、采用数据压缩技术
针对频繁访问的数据,采用数据压缩技术,降低存储空间占用。
存储池数据布局对存储系统的性能和稳定性至关重要,通过优化存储池数据布局,可以提高数据访问速度、降低延迟、提高数据可靠性,在实际应用中,应根据业务需求和存储设备的性能,选择合适的存储池类型、数据分布策略、数据校验方法和数据压缩技术,实现存储池的优化配置。
标签: #存储池数据布局
评论列表